Rana Sanaullah urges political unity and inclusive dialogue

Prime Minister’s adviser Rana Sanaullah reiterated the government’s commitment to facilitating successful dialogue during a seminar marking the death anniversary of Khawaja Muhammad Rafique, the father of Khawaja Saad Rafique.

In his address, Rana Sanaullah stressed the importance of including prominent political leaders, such as Nawaz Sharif, Asif Zardari, and Imran Khan, in the dialogue process.

He expressed concern over the rising culture of intolerance in society, saying, “You filed false cases against us, and now PTI claims that the cases against them are unfounded.”

Commenting on PTI’s negotiation team, he remarked, “The team members are just actors, while Khawaja Saad Rafique is the producer pulling the strings behind the scenes.”

Rana Sanaullah also paid tribute to Khawaja Muhammad Rafique, calling him a fearless political leader who resisted oppression. “He was martyred 52 years ago for opposing the ruling regime of his time. His voice was silenced because the government could not bear his dissent,” he said.

In closing, he noted, “That same courageous spirit lives on in Khawaja Saad Rafique, who continues to demonstrate the same resolve and energy.”
